INDIANAPOLIS – UIndy student-athlete
Pilar Echeverria added to an already crowded trophy case Thursday, collecting her fifth GLVC weekly award of the season and 13th of her career – both good for conference records. The junior garnered the current GLVC Women's Golf Player of the Week award after taking medalist honors at the 104-woman NC4K Classic earlier this week.
Â
A native of Guatemala, Echeverria finished at -1 with a scores of 72-71 to win her fourth individual medal and seventh top-five performance in nine events on the season. She helped the Hounds overcome a five-stroke deficit after 18 holes to win the team title by nine shots among the mostly-Midwest-Region field.
Â
Echeverria and her teammates next compete at the Ohio State Lady Buckeye Invitational April 13-14 before the postseason begins with the GLVC Championships later this month.
